Exploring the Historic Hartley Village Near Blue Mountains National Park

Exploring the Historic Hartley Village Near Blue Mountains National Park

Nestled near the stunning Blue Mountains National Park, Hartley Village is a hidden gem that encapsulates the charm and history of Australia's early colonial days. This quaint village, established in the 1830s, offers visitors a unique blend of scenic beauty, historical architecture, and rich cultural heritage.

Historic Significance of Hartley Village

Hartley Village is often referred to as one of the best-preserved remnants of Australia's colonial past. It was initially a vital service centre for the surrounding mining and agricultural communities. Today, the village is recognized for its fascinating historical buildings, including the Hartley Courthouse, built in 1837, and the Old Hartley Goal, which stands testament to the village’s past as a crucial judicial location.

Accessing Hartley Village

Hartley Village is conveniently located about two hours from Sydney, making it an ideal day trip for those looking to escape the hustle and bustle of city life. Accessible by car, visitors can take the Great Western Highway and enjoy a scenic drive through the picturesque countryside.
